Abstract

Abstract We report the synthesis of a new carbon material—diamond-like carbon film codeposited with 1% C60 molecules—by plasma-assisted chemical vapor deposition. The synthesized films exhibited strong iridescent colors after being exposed to an atmosphere containing water vapor. An electron microscopy examination revealed that the film expanded by a factor of more than two, while forming 10–100-nm-sized grain-like structures after its exposure to water vapor. This work demonstrates a new concept of incorporating reaction centers in carbon solids to make carbon-based nanostructures.
